For high-performance applications, standard static CMOS is sometimes insufficient. Kang introduces dynamic logic families (such as Domino logic) and analyzes their vulnerabilities to charge sharing and leakage. Additionally, the book covers memory architecture, including SRAM, DRAM, and non-volatile flash memory designs. 5. Furthermore, the fourth edition features major updates to reflect the realities of (process nodes below 100nm). The transistor model equations and device parameters have been revised to address short-channel effects, leakage current, and process-voltage-temperature (PVT) variations that dominate modern chip design.
